About 2-ethyl-N-(1,3-thiazol-2-yl)pyrazole-3-carboxamide
2-ethyl-N-(1,3-thiazol-2-yl)pyrazole-3-carboxamide (PubChem CID 649902) has the molecular formula C9H10N4OS
and a molecular weight of 222.27 g/mol. Its IUPAC name is 2-ethyl-N-(1,3-thiazol-2-yl)pyrazole-3-carboxamide.
